Thar Population - Wardha, Maharashtra
Thar is a medium size village located in Ashti Taluka of Wardha district, Maharashtra with total 295 families residing. The Thar village has population of 1302 of which 684 are males while 618 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Thar village population of children with age 0-6 is 125 which makes up 9.60 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Thar village is 904 which is lower than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Thar as per census is 1119,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.
Thar village has higher liter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Thar village was 85.47 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Thar Male literacy stands at 91.84 % while female literacy rate was 78.26 %.

Thar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 295 | - | - |
Population | 1,302 | 684 | 618 |
Child (0-6) | 125 | 59 | 66 |
Schedule Caste | 310 | 161 | 149 |
Schedule Tribe | 521 | 271 | 250 |
Literacy | 85.47 % | 91.84 % | 78.26 % |
Total Workers | 609 | 422 | 187 |
Main Worker | 430 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 179 | 93 | 86 |
